What Is Swarm Intelligence
 
- Traders deciding on the next big market bet.- A navigation app quickly mapping out a less-explored area.- Fashion brands choosing the hottest color of the season.- An airport managing fight delays.
 
What do these scenarios have in common?
 
In each one, swarm intelligence blends global and local insight to improve how businesses make decisions.
 
Swarm intelligence is a form of artificial intelligence (AI) inspired by the insect kingdom. In nature, it describes how honeybees migrate, how ants form perfect trails, and how birds flock. In the world of AI, swarm systems draw input from individual people or machine sensors and then use algorithms to optimize the overall performance of the group or system in real time.
 
Consider Waze, the popular road navigation app that uses swarm intelligence to create and modify maps. Starting with limited digital maps, it began making tweaks based on its users’ GPS data along with manual map modifications by registered users. Entire cities have been mapped using this method, as was the case in Costa Rica’s capital, San José. And just as ants signal danger to their counterparts, so too do Waze users contribute live information from accident locations and traffic jams.
 
Swarm intelligence is now being used to predict everything from the outcome of the Super Bowl to fashion trends to major political events. Using swarm intelligence, investors can better predict market movements, and retailers can more accurately forecast sales.

    The Key West Quail-dove was discovered on Key West and that is how the bird received its name. Today this bird is only a rare visitor to Florida from islands in the Caribbean. It walks under very dense cover, and is often difficult to find even where it is common.This audio recording features Key West quail birdsong in its natural habitat together with other birds of tropical islands.
